
Metropolis 25 BF PCB - Sit 6NW10 Transformer
The Metropolis 25 BF electronic PCB - Sit 6NW10 transformer is the component that controls the ignition, burner modulation, pump, and safety features of the boiler. When it fails, the boiler may not start, become locked, or exhibit erratic behavior. This model is compatible with boilers from the Metropolis range, as well as other models from the Climit GG M, Format ZIP, Format ZIP 5, and Formel ranges. How to check if ref. 6230630 is the part for your boiler
What determines it is not the boiler model, but the reference printed on the part you already have installed.
- Find the reference printed on the installed part and check whether it matches the catalogue reference 6230630. If it is not visible, do not identify the part from its shape alone.
- Check the full boiler model on its data plate and look for it in the model associations on this page.
- Compare the connections and physical body with the original part before installation.

Symptoms and faults that the PCB 6230630 resolves.
The PCB controls the ignition, modulation, and safety features of the boiler. These are the typical symptoms and what to do:
Common symptoms and faults
- 01
The boiler does not turn on at all, neither the display nor the indicators.
Cause: The transformer on the PCB is not supplying power to the 24V circuits, which prevents control and display.
With a multimeter, measure if there is 230V at the input of the transformer and if there is current at the output before replacing the complete PCB.
- 02
The boiler turns off intermittently for no apparent reason.
Cause: A transformer that loses current in an unstable manner causes intermittent cuts in the low voltage control circuits.
Observe if the fault occurs more after several hours of operation; this may indicate a transformer that degrades with heat.
- 03
The room thermostat does not start the boiler even though it is calling for heat.
Cause: The thermostat signal does not reach the PCB because there is no power in the 24V circuit, so the demand is not processed.
Check the thermostat connection directly at the terminals of the PCB to rule out an external wiring issue.
- 04
The solenoid valves or the fan do not receive a command to activate.
Cause: These components depend on the low voltage circuits that come from the transformer on the PCB.
Make sure that no fuses or thermal switches have tripped before replacing the entire PCB due to a transformer fault.
